如何更改in_stock verbose_name?
Models.py
class Book(models.Model): name = models.CharField(u"???", max_length = 200) @property def in_stock(self): return self.stocks.count()
我是Admin.py
class BookAdmin(admin.ModelAdmin):
list_display = ('name', 'in_stock')
search_fields = ('name', )
jar*_*lan 41
我猜你应该使用short_description属性.Django的管理
def in_stock(self):
return self.stocks.count()
in_stock.short_description = 'Your label here'
Run Code Online (Sandbox Code Playgroud)
将您的模型和 verbose_name 参数更改为字段。我将“作者”标签更改为“作者”
模型.py
class books(models.Model):
title = models.CharField(max_length = 250)
author= models.CharField(max_length = 250, verbose_name='Author(s)')
Run Code Online (Sandbox Code Playgroud)
或者简单地
author = models.CharField('Author(s)',max_length = 250)
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
14028 次 |
| 最近记录: |